Don’t Ignore Pulsatile Tinnitus: Signs of a Ruptured Eardrum
Pulsatile tinnitus, a condition where you hear a rhythmic thumping or whooshing sound in your ear that synchronizes with your heartbeat, could be an indication of a more serious problem such as a ruptured eardrum. While pulsatile tinnitus can have various causes, a ruptured eardrum can lead to this symptom due to changes in pressure within the ear. Ignoring this sign could potentially worsen the condition and lead to further complications. It is essential to recognize the signs of a ruptured eardrum early on to seek appropriate treatment.
One of the key indicators of a ruptured eardrum accompanied by pulsatile tinnitus is sudden sharp ear pain followed by hearing loss or a ringing sensation in the affected ear. In some cases, there may also be discharge from the ear or dizziness. If you experience any of these symptoms, it is crucial to consult a healthcare professional promptly for a proper diagnosis and treatment plan. Delaying medical attention can result in prolonged discomfort and potential damage to your ear health.
When dealing with pulsatile tinnitus resulting from a ruptured eardrum, it is important to address the underlying cause to alleviate the symptoms and promote healing. Depending on the severity of the condition, treatment options may include medications, ear drops, or in some cases, surgery. It is essential to follow the guidance of your healthcare provider to effectively manage the condition and prevent any further complications.
